Okay this is going to be long
A lot of people in web3 still think NFTs are just JPEGs. Monkey pictures and pixel art. But no
The technology behind NFTs is actually incredible
A NFT is simply proof of ownership on a blockchain. That's it
What you attach to that proof is where it gets interesting
Imagine buying a house and the deed is an NFT. No lawyers. No 3 months of paperwork. Ownership transfers in one transaction. Recorded on the blockchain forever
Imagine an artist dropping a song as an NFT. Every time it's streamed or resold the artist gets paid automatically. No label taking 80%. The artist owns their work forever
Imagine your concert ticket is an NFT. Can't be counterfeited. Can't be faked at the gate. And the artist earns from every resale
Imagine your medical records as encrypted NFTs that only you control. You can witch doctors and share access in one click instead of filling out 15 forms
Imagine your university degree as an NFT. An employer verifies it on the blockchain in seconds. No more fake certificates
Imagine buying a designer bag and scanning an NFT tag to prove it's authentic. No more fakes. Verified in 2 seconds
The people who say NFTs are dead are confusing the JPEG era with the technology
NFTs were never about just art
They were always about ownership
